华为,作为全球领先的通信解决方案提供商,其手机产品线在全球范围内拥有庞大的用户群体。对于开发者来说,掌握华为手机开发技能,无疑是一个非常有价值的能力。本文将为你提供一份华为手机开发者快速入门指南,帮助你轻松开启手机开发之旅。
一、了解华为手机开发环境
在开始华为手机开发之前,你需要了解以下开发环境:
- 华为开发者联盟:这是华为官方的开发者平台,提供最新的开发工具、文档和教程。
- Android Studio:华为手机开发主要基于Android平台,因此需要安装Android Studio。
- 华为移动服务:华为提供了一系列移动服务,如推送、地图、支付等,开发者可以利用这些服务丰富自己的应用。
二、安装开发工具
- 下载并安装Android Studio:从华为开发者联盟官网下载最新版本的Android Studio,并按照提示完成安装。
- 配置Android Studio:安装完成后,需要配置Android Studio,包括设置SDK、模拟器等。
三、创建第一个华为手机应用
- 创建新项目:打开Android Studio,选择“Start a new Android Studio project”,然后选择“Empty Activity”模板。
- 填写项目信息:填写项目名称、保存位置等信息,并选择最低支持的Android版本。
- 编写代码:在主Activity中编写代码,例如,在布局文件中添加一个按钮,并在按钮的点击事件中输出“Hello World”。
- 运行应用:连接华为手机到电脑,并确保已开启USB调试。在Android Studio中点击“Run”按钮,即可将应用安装到手机上并运行。
四、掌握华为手机开发技巧
- 使用华为移动服务:华为移动服务提供了丰富的功能,如推送、地图、支付等,开发者可以利用这些服务为用户提供更好的体验。
- 优化性能:关注应用的性能,如内存、CPU、电量等,确保应用流畅运行。
- 遵守华为开发者规范:了解并遵守华为开发者规范,确保应用符合华为的要求。
五、深入学习华为手机开发
- 阅读官方文档:华为开发者联盟官网提供了丰富的开发文档,包括API参考、开发教程等。
- 加入开发者社区:加入华为开发者社区,与其他开发者交流学习,共同进步。
- 参加华为开发者活动:华为定期举办开发者活动,如技术沙龙、培训课程等,开发者可以参加这些活动提升自己的技能。
六、总结
华为手机开发是一项具有挑战性的工作,但只要掌握了正确的入门方法,你就能轻松开启手机开发之旅。希望这份快速入门指南能帮助你快速上手,成为一名优秀的华为手机开发者。
